As a Registered Nurse (RN) in the Critical Care Unit (CCU) at WVU Medicine's United Hospital Center (UHC), you will play a vital role in providing comprehensive and compassionate care to critically ill patients. This position requires a high level of clinical expertise, critical thinking skills, and the ability to work effectively in a fast-paced, high-pressure environment. The CCU RN is responsible for assessing, planning, implementing, and evaluating patient care, as well as collaborating with physicians and other healthcare professionals to ensure the best possible outcomes for patients.
This position offers an exciting opportunity to contribute to a dynamic team of healthcare professionals dedicated to providing exceptional care to the community. The CCU at UHC is equipped with state-of-the-art technology and resources, allowing nurses to deliver cutting-edge care to patients with complex medical needs.
